A simple python CLI script to query inspirehep.net and populate bibliography databases.
An iNSPIRE CLI script using its REST API.
This script requires python 3.9
or above.
The requirements can be installed via
python -m pip install -r requirements.txt
or manually inspect the requirements.txt
file.
Simply pass an iNSPIRE query to the command line and use the --display
(-d
) option to control the output:
When there are multiple matches, --size
controls the number of records to retrieve and --sort
the sorting order. The wanted entries can be easily selected from the menu:
The selected entries can be added to an existing bibliography by specifying the file with --bib
(-b
). Omitting the file name will use the default BibTeX file specified in the configuration:
We can also update all records of an existing BibTeX file by adding the --update
(-u
) option:
In the configuration file, you can also specify a default folder for PDF downloads. The option --pdf
will try to find the PDF from arXiv and download it to that folder.
